Biography

Vincent Davy, a renowned French actor and director, entered this world on September 24, 1940, in the picturesque town of Enghien-les-Bains, nestled in the charming Val-d'Oise region of France. Born with a passion for the performing arts, Davy's career was marked by a wide range of notable roles in film, television, and theater.

Throughout his illustrious career, Davy was recognized for his captivating performances in various productions, including the critically acclaimed Assassin's Creed: Revelations, released in 2011. Additionally, he appeared in the historical drama Le trésor de Nouvelle-France, which premiered in 1979, and the critically acclaimed drama Laurence Anyways, released in 2012.

Sadly, Vincent Davy's life came to a close on January 16, 2021, in Saint-Charles-Borromée, Québec, Canada. Despite his passing, his legacy lives on through his remarkable body of work, which continues to inspire and entertain audiences to this day.
